Output 535f62c82fbe3665a2484a959d0890e3147ed78a6c50b47834aef61116af2aae:4

value
4601433591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9ab51230790ec6caba9579f191d35efa051a973 OP_EQUAL
address
3MXwnUqFffD44FEdspBuiopnPCvGYasoYX
transaction
535f62c82fbe3665a2484a959d0890e3147ed78a6c50b47834aef61116af2aae
spent
true